Offering Condolences · 表达慰问

basic
You

I'm so sorry for your loss. Your mother was a wonderful person. She always made everyone feel welcome.

对你的损失深表遗憾。你母亲是一位很好的人。她总是让每个人感到被欢迎。

Thank you so much for coming. It means a lot to our family. She always spoke so highly of you. Would you like to sign the guest book?

非常感谢你能来。对我们家庭意义重大。她一直很夸你。你要签一下留言簿吗?

You

Of course. Is there anything I can do to help? I'm happy to help with anything you need.

当然。有什么我能帮忙的吗?任何需要的我都愿意帮。

That's very kind of you. We're having a reception at the house afterwards. If you could help set up the food, that would be wonderful. But please, just being here is enough.

你太好了。之后我们在家里有一个招待会。如果你能帮忙摆放食物,那就太好了。但请放心,你能来就已经够了。

You

I'll definitely be there to help. The service was beautiful — the stories people shared were so touching.

我一定会去帮忙的。仪式很美——大家分享的故事太感人了。

💡 At US funerals, it is common to have a reception or gathering with food after the service. Bringing a dish or offering to help is appreciated.

Thank you. She lived such a full life. We're going to miss her dearly, but knowing how many people she touched — it helps. Thank you for being part of her life.

谢谢。她过了充实的一生。我们会非常想念她,但知道她影响了这么多人——这让我们欣慰。谢谢你是她生命的一部分。

Sharing Memories · 追思和分享回忆

intermediate
You

Would it be alright if I shared a memory of your mother? She did something incredibly kind for me when I first moved here.

我可以分享一段关于你母亲的回忆吗?我刚搬来的时候她做了一件非常好的事。

We would love that. She was always helping people, especially newcomers to the neighborhood. Please, go ahead.

我们很想听。她总是帮助别人,尤其是社区的新人。请说吧。

You

When I first arrived, I didn't know anyone and barely spoke English. She came over with a home-cooked meal and sat with me for an hour, just talking and making me feel at home.

我刚来的时候,谁都不认识,英语也几乎不会说。她带着一顿家常饭来看我,陪我坐了一个小时,就是聊天让我有家的感觉。

That is so her. She believed no one should ever feel alone. Thank you for sharing that — it means more than you know. She would be glad to know the impact she had on you.

那太像她了。她相信没有人应该感到孤独。谢谢你分享这个——比你知道的意义更大。她会很高兴知道她对你的影响。

You

She changed my life. If there's anything you need in the coming weeks — meals, errands, anything — please don't hesitate to call me.

她改变了我的生活。接下来几周如果你需要什么——饭菜、跑腿、任何事——请不要犹豫打电话给我。

You're so kind. We'll take you up on that — the next few weeks are going to be tough. Having support from friends like you makes all the difference. Thank you, truly.

你太好了。我们会接受你的好意——接下来几周会很难。有你这样的朋友支持真的不一样。真心感谢你。

Cultural Notes · 文化注释

  • At US funerals, it is common to have a reception or gathering with food after the service. Bringing a dish or offering to help is appreciated.
